Overview of the JOOLA Vision CGS 14mm
The JOOLA Vision CGS 14mm is a high-quality pickleball paddle designed to offer enhanced spin, control, and maneuverability. It’s engineered with JOOLA’s Carbon Grip Surface (CGS) technology, making it a standout option for players who rely on precision shots and strategic gameplay.
Key Features
- Carbon Grip Surface (CGS): Enhances spin and ball control
- 14mm Polymer Core: Offers a balance of power and touch
- Aero-Curve Design: Improves swing speed and maneuverability
- Lightweight Construction: Ideal for quick reactions at the net
- Sure-Grip Handle: Provides superior comfort and reduced vibration

Performance Breakdown
Spin & Control
One of the standout features of the JOOLA Vision CGS 14mm is its Carbon Grip Surface. This technology enhances the paddle’s ability to generate spin, making it easier to put a curve on your shots and keep opponents on their toes.
If you frequently use top-spin or slice shots, you’ll appreciate how well this paddle grips the ball, allowing for precise placement and controlled returns.
Power & Touch
While it’s not the most powerful paddle on the market, the 14mm polymer core provides a solid blend of power and touch. It offers enough pop for aggressive shots while maintaining excellent control for dinks and drop shots.
For players transitioning from a thicker core paddle (16mm), the JOOLA Vision CGS 14mm may feel slightly more responsive but still provides ample stability.
Maneuverability & Comfort
With its aero-curve design and lightweight frame, this paddle excels in quick exchanges at the net. The ergonomic handle ensures comfort during extended play, and the reduced vibration helps minimize hand fatigue.

Advanced Strategies to Maximize Performance
Mastering Spin Techniques
With its CGS surface, this paddle thrives in spin-based play. To fully utilize this feature:
- Topspin Drives: Brush up on the ball with a fast, upward motion.
- Cut Shots: Use a slicing motion to keep the ball low and unpredictable.
- Angle Shots: Take advantage of spin to send shots wide and force opponents out of position.
Improving Net Play
The aero-curve design makes this paddle ideal for quick volleys and fast exchanges. Here’s how to make the most of it:
- Stay light on your feet to react quickly at the net.
- Keep your paddle up and ready to counter fast shots.
- Use soft hands to control drop volleys effectively.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. Is the JOOLA Vision CGS 14mm good for beginners? Yes, but it may take some time to adjust to the spin-focused design. Beginners looking for long-term improvement will benefit from the paddle’s precision and control.
2. How does the 14mm thickness affect performance? A 14mm core provides a balance between power and control. It’s thinner than a 16mm paddle, making it more responsive and maneuverable while still offering decent stability.
3. Is this paddle suitable for doubles play? Absolutely! The lightweight design and quick-hand response make it an excellent choice for fast-paced doubles matches.
4. How does this paddle compare to the JOOLA Hyperion? The Vision CGS 14mm is lighter and offers better spin control, while the Hyperion provides more power and stability due to its thicker core.
5. What grip size does this paddle have? The JOOLA Vision CGS 14mm features a 4 1/8-inch grip circumference, which is comfortable for most players. If you prefer a thicker grip, adding an overgrip is a great option.
